U.S. stocks were slightly lower as oil and 10yr treasury yields ticked higher. Gold, silver and bitcoin rose, and chip names were mixed. $Broadcom(AVGO.US) slipped after slight miss in revenue guidance. U.S.-Iran strikes continued with no resolution in sight. Traders priced a 62% chance of a Sept. Fed hike, although I don’t see it given slowing job growth and temporary nature of oil supply shock. S&P 500 2026 EPS estimates have continued to climb on AI and energy sector gains. S&P 500 forward earnings yield remains below 10-year treasury yield (no equity risk premium; normal +50-100 bp premium). Tesla’s Austin Cybercab event is today; I remain cautious on $Tesla(TSLA.US) shares amid negative TSLA long term earnings revisions, unsupervised autonomy being commoditized, and an extended valuation.
